完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
嗨,大家好,
简而言之:在哪些情况下可以引发一个FIQ中断,并调用一个YyCu3PFIQHANDER? 今天我观察到奇怪的固件冻结。我把JTAG连接到我的板上,停止CPU。在堆栈跟踪中,我看到代码执行点位于y*CYU3PFIQHANDLE处理程序中。我在CYU3NETYYGAGC.S中查看IT实现,发现它是一个简单的无限循环。下一个评论让我困惑: “在此设置上不期望出现以下异常。处理人员留在原地准备完成。” 和AY-CYU3PFIQHANDER实现: 全局Y.CYU3PFIQHANDELL Y-CYU3PFIQHANTELL: By*CYU3PFIQHANTELL如果我正确理解,如果发生快速中断,则所有IRQ和FIQ中断都被屏蔽。在SDK代码中,FIQ中断处理程序永远不会完成,因此系统完全冻结。 我不知道FIQ中断的原因是什么。 谢谢你的帮助。 |
|
相关推荐
1个回答
|
|
我们根本不在固件中注册任何FIQ,这就是为什么处理程序是无限循环的原因。FIQ根本不会发生。
我们经常使用SEGER J-Link调试器并且没有看到这个问题。 你用的是原来的SDK库或你有来自我们提供的编译? |
|
|
|
只有小组成员才能发言,加入小组>>
756个成员聚集在这个小组
加入小组2121 浏览 1 评论
1864 浏览 1 评论
3679 浏览 1 评论
请问可以直接使用来自FX2LP固件的端点向主机FIFO写入数据吗?
1799 浏览 6 评论
1542 浏览 1 评论
CY8C4025LQI在程序中调用函数,通过示波器观察SCL引脚波形,无法将pin0.4(SCL)下拉是什么原因导致?
588浏览 2评论
CYUSB3065焊接到USB3.0 TYPE-B口的焊接触点就无法使用是什么原因导致的?
439浏览 2评论
CX3连接Camera修改分辨率之后,播放器无法播出camera的画面怎么解决?
446浏览 2评论
395浏览 2评论
使用stm32+cyw43438 wifi驱动whd,WHD驱动固件加载失败的原因?
1056浏览 2评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2025-1-3 01:55 , Processed in 0.720501 second(s), Total 45, Slave 40 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号